Player Story

Sander Sahaydak story

Sander Sahaydak built his college career from 2022 through 2024 as a placekicker from Bethlehem, PA wearing No. 93, spending time with Penn State. The clearest part of Sander Sahaydak's career was his special-teams scoring: 34 kicking points, 3 made field goals on 9 attempts, and 25 extra points across 11 career games in the available record. His career also includes 1 tackle, giving the story more than a single-category snapshot.
